Parochial Reports
Parochial reports are sent to the parish offices in early January and are due March 1. The reports must be signed off on by the vestry. Forms are posted in early January each year and can be found here and in the forms directory over to the right.
Every congregation is required by canon to complete an annual statistical report called the parochial report. The forms are designed by the National Church, and are divided into two sections: (1) Membership, Attendance and Services, (2) Stewardship and Financial Information.
In addition, as many other dioceses do, the Diocese of Washington includes several other forms for the congregation to complete. We currently request information about compensation for clergy, lay employees and musicians for the diocesan Human Resources Committee, as well as attendance figures for the four key Sundays in order to compute the delegate apportionment for the next year's Convention.
The forms are sent to the congregation in January/February every year and are due in the diocesan office on March 1. Forms (see right column of this page) may be submitted online or downloaded and mailed in. To request an extension for filing, please contact the governance office as soon as possible.
We encourage the congregation to take the opportunity to compare the parochial report to the ones done in preceding years in order to take stock of some of the measurable things about the congregation. For instance, everyone is always aware when there are lots of newcomers – how does that compare to the number of departures or the number of pledge units or the attendance. Every number tells a story.
A compilation of the statistics from the parochial report can be found in the tables at the back of the annual Diocesan Journal and Directory.

Extensions
If for some compelling reason you cannot make the deadline, be in touch with the Governance Office to request an extension in writing. Extensions are given for 2-4 weeks. Please note that the deadline is set by the National Church, as are the questions.

Normal Operating Income
Remember, any costs that go into the regular operation of the church are considered to be part of Normal Operating Income, no matter how it may be funded. It is also this item that we want you to look at this year for last year's figures when pledging a percentage for the following year. (2011 report being filled out in 2012, and pledging 2013).
No negative amounts or cents
Do not insert any negative numbers in the Parochial Report – if you think you need to, call up and talk it over because it means that you're not quite understanding how to fill out the report. Also, please use whole dollars – the online filing that is required cannot accept cents.
